How can parents help their children develop healthy relationships with technology and screen time?

Helping children develop a healthy relationship with technology and screen time requires balance, guidance, and setting clear boundaries. Here’s how parents can promote responsible tech use:

1. Set Age-Appropriate Screen Time Limits

  • Follow recommended guidelines (e.g., the American Academy of Pediatrics suggests no screens for kids under 18 months, limited time for toddlers, and balanced use for older kids).
  • Use timers or parental control apps to enforce limits.

2. Encourage Screen Time with Purpose

  • Prioritize educational and creative content over passive entertainment.
  • Encourage coding, digital art, or interactive learning apps instead of endless scrolling or gaming.

3. Create Screen-Free Zones & Times

  • No screens during meals, before bedtime, or in bedrooms.
  • Have tech-free family time (e.g., game nights, outdoor play, or storytelling).

4. Model Healthy Tech Habits

  • Kids learn by watching, limit your own screen time and avoid constant phone use.
  • Show them how to use technology mindfully, not as an escape.

5. Teach Digital Responsibility & Online Safety

  • Educate them on cyberbullying, privacy, and safe online behavior.
  • Teach them not to share personal information and to report anything suspicious.

6. Encourage Offline Activities

  • Promote hobbies, sports, reading, and outdoor play.
  • Help them find balance between online and offline fun.

7. Use Parental Controls & Monitor Usage

  • Set up child-friendly filters and privacy settings.
  • Regularly check what they’re watching, playing, and interacting with.

8. Teach Self-Regulation

  • Encourage them to notice how screen time makes them feel, tired, distracted, or overstimulated?
  • Teach them to take breaks and engage in other activities.

9. Watch & Play Together

  • Engage with their digital interests by watching shows, playing games, or learning apps together.
  • This creates bonding time and helps you understand their online world.

10. Have Open Conversations About Technology

  • Instead of banning, discuss the pros and cons of screen time.
  • Encourage them to talk about what they see online and ask questions.
